无码不卡一区二区三区在线观看,和邻居少妇愉情中文字幕,久久人人爽天天玩人人妻精品,国产在线一区二区在线视频

當(dāng)前位置:首頁 > 網(wǎng)站優(yōu)化 > 正文內(nèi)容

如何優(yōu)化外貿(mào)網(wǎng)站的數(shù)據(jù)庫性能,提升效率與用戶體驗的關(guān)鍵策略

znbo3周前 (04-13)網(wǎng)站優(yōu)化244

本文目錄導(dǎo)讀:

  1. 引言
  2. 一、數(shù)據(jù)庫性能優(yōu)化的必要性
  3. 二、外貿(mào)網(wǎng)站數(shù)據(jù)庫優(yōu)化的核心策略
  4. 三、外貿(mào)網(wǎng)站特有的優(yōu)化技巧
  5. 四、案例分析:某外貿(mào)B2B網(wǎng)站的數(shù)據(jù)庫優(yōu)化實踐
  6. 五、總結(jié)

在全球化的商業(yè)環(huán)境中,外貿(mào)網(wǎng)站是企業(yè)拓展國際市場的重要工具,隨著數(shù)據(jù)量的增長和用戶訪問量的增加,數(shù)據(jù)庫性能問題可能成為制約網(wǎng)站速度和用戶體驗的瓶頸,優(yōu)化外貿(mào)網(wǎng)站的數(shù)據(jù)庫性能不僅能提高頁面加載速度,還能增強搜索引擎排名,降低服務(wù)器成本,從而提升整體業(yè)務(wù)表現(xiàn),本文將深入探討如何通過多種策略優(yōu)化外貿(mào)網(wǎng)站的數(shù)據(jù)庫性能。

如何優(yōu)化外貿(mào)網(wǎng)站的數(shù)據(jù)庫性能,提升效率與用戶體驗的關(guān)鍵策略


數(shù)據(jù)庫性能優(yōu)化的必要性

外貿(mào)網(wǎng)站通常需要處理多語言、多幣種、大量產(chǎn)品信息和用戶數(shù)據(jù),數(shù)據(jù)庫的響應(yīng)速度直接影響用戶體驗和轉(zhuǎn)化率,數(shù)據(jù)庫性能不佳可能導(dǎo)致以下問題:

  1. 頁面加載緩慢:用戶等待時間過長,增加跳出率。
  2. 高并發(fā)訪問時崩潰:影響業(yè)務(wù)連續(xù)性。
  3. SEO排名下降:搜索引擎(如Google)更傾向于推薦加載速度快的網(wǎng)站。
  4. 服務(wù)器資源浪費:低效查詢占用過多CPU和內(nèi)存資源。

優(yōu)化數(shù)據(jù)庫性能是外貿(mào)網(wǎng)站運營中不可忽視的關(guān)鍵環(huán)節(jié)。


外貿(mào)網(wǎng)站數(shù)據(jù)庫優(yōu)化的核心策略

數(shù)據(jù)庫設(shè)計與規(guī)范化

(1)合理設(shè)計表結(jié)構(gòu)

  • 避免冗余數(shù)據(jù),采用第三范式(3NF)設(shè)計數(shù)據(jù)庫,減少數(shù)據(jù)重復(fù)。
  • 使用適當(dāng)?shù)臄?shù)據(jù)類型(如VARCHAR代替TEXT,INT代替BIGINT),減少存儲空間。
  • 為多語言網(wǎng)站設(shè)計國際化表結(jié)構(gòu),例如使用product表和product_translations表存儲不同語言版本。

(2)索引優(yōu)化

  • 為常用查詢字段(如product_idcategory_id)建立索引,加快查詢速度。
  • 避免過度索引,因為索引會增加寫入時的開銷。
  • 使用復(fù)合索引優(yōu)化多條件查詢(如WHERE category_id=1 AND price>100)。

(3)分區(qū)與分表

  • 對于大型數(shù)據(jù)庫,可以采用水平分區(qū)(按時間或ID范圍拆分?jǐn)?shù)據(jù))或垂直分區(qū)(按列拆分)。
  • 將訂單表按年份分區(qū),提高歷史數(shù)據(jù)查詢效率。

查詢優(yōu)化

(1)避免全表掃描

  • 使用EXPLAIN分析SQL查詢執(zhí)行計劃,確保查詢使用索引。
  • 避免SELECT *,只查詢必要的字段。

(2)優(yōu)化JOIN操作

  • 減少多表JOIN,尤其是大數(shù)據(jù)量的表。
  • 使用INNER JOIN替代LEFT JOIN(如果不需要NULL值)。

(3)緩存常用查詢

  • 使用RedisMemcached緩存熱門產(chǎn)品、分類數(shù)據(jù),減少數(shù)據(jù)庫壓力。
  • 外貿(mào)網(wǎng)站的產(chǎn)品目錄可以緩存24小時,避免頻繁查詢數(shù)據(jù)庫。

(4)批量操作代替循環(huán)

  • 使用INSERT INTO ... VALUES (...), (...), (...)代替單條插入。
  • 使用UPDATE ... WHERE ... IN (...)批量更新數(shù)據(jù)。

數(shù)據(jù)庫服務(wù)器優(yōu)化

(1)選擇合適的數(shù)據(jù)庫引擎

  • MySQL:適合大多數(shù)外貿(mào)網(wǎng)站,支持事務(wù)和復(fù)雜查詢。
  • PostgreSQL:適合高并發(fā)、復(fù)雜查詢場景。
  • MongoDB:適合非結(jié)構(gòu)化數(shù)據(jù)(如用戶行為日志)。

(2)調(diào)整數(shù)據(jù)庫配置

  • 優(yōu)化innodb_buffer_pool_size(MySQL)或shared_buffers(PostgreSQL),提高內(nèi)存利用率。
  • 調(diào)整max_connections,避免連接數(shù)過多導(dǎo)致性能下降。

(3)讀寫分離

  • 主數(shù)據(jù)庫負(fù)責(zé)寫入,從數(shù)據(jù)庫負(fù)責(zé)讀取,減輕主庫壓力。
  • 使用ProxySQLMySQL Router實現(xiàn)自動負(fù)載均衡。

數(shù)據(jù)清理與歸檔

(1)定期清理無用數(shù)據(jù)

  • 刪除過期的會話數(shù)據(jù)、日志、臨時表。
  • 使用OPTIMIZE TABLE(MySQL)或VACUUM(PostgreSQL)減少碎片。

(2)歸檔歷史數(shù)據(jù)

  • 將舊訂單、日志移至歸檔表或冷存儲(如AWS S3)。
  • 使用分區(qū)表或分庫分表策略,提高查詢效率。

監(jiān)控與自動化維護

(1)數(shù)據(jù)庫監(jiān)控工具

  • 使用Prometheus + Grafana監(jiān)控數(shù)據(jù)庫性能指標(biāo)(QPS、慢查詢、連接數(shù))。
  • 使用pt-query-digest(Percona Toolkit)分析慢查詢?nèi)罩尽?/li>

(2)自動化維護腳本

  • 定期執(zhí)行ANALYZE TABLE更新統(tǒng)計信息。
  • 設(shè)置定時任務(wù)清理日志、備份數(shù)據(jù)。

外貿(mào)網(wǎng)站特有的優(yōu)化技巧

多語言數(shù)據(jù)優(yōu)化

  • 使用JSON字段存儲多語言文本(MySQL 5.7+支持),減少JOIN操作。
  • 為不同語言版本建立獨立的緩存鍵(如product_1_en、product_1_es)。

匯率與價格計算優(yōu)化

  • 避免實時計算匯率,可以每天更新一次緩存。
  • 使用DECIMAL存儲價格,避免浮點數(shù)精度問題。

CDN與數(shù)據(jù)庫結(jié)合

  • 靜態(tài)資源(如圖片、CSS)使用CDN加速,減少數(shù)據(jù)庫負(fù)載,如用戶訂單)仍由數(shù)據(jù)庫處理。

案例分析:某外貿(mào)B2B網(wǎng)站的數(shù)據(jù)庫優(yōu)化實踐

問題:某外貿(mào)B2B網(wǎng)站產(chǎn)品數(shù)據(jù)達(dá)100萬條,頁面加載時間超過5秒。

優(yōu)化措施

  1. 重構(gòu)數(shù)據(jù)庫表,建立復(fù)合索引(category_id + price)。
  2. 使用Redis緩存熱門分類和產(chǎn)品數(shù)據(jù)。
  3. 優(yōu)化SQL查詢,避免SELECT *,改用分頁查詢。
  4. 啟用MySQL查詢緩存和InnoDB緩沖池優(yōu)化。

結(jié)果:頁面加載時間降至1秒內(nèi),服務(wù)器CPU使用率下降40%。


優(yōu)化外貿(mào)網(wǎng)站的數(shù)據(jù)庫性能是一個系統(tǒng)工程,涉及數(shù)據(jù)庫設(shè)計、查詢優(yōu)化、服務(wù)器配置、數(shù)據(jù)清理和監(jiān)控等多個方面,通過合理的索引策略、緩存機制、讀寫分離和自動化維護,可以顯著提升網(wǎng)站響應(yīng)速度,改善用戶體驗,并降低服務(wù)器成本,對于外貿(mào)企業(yè)而言,高效的數(shù)據(jù)庫性能不僅能提升SEO排名,還能增強客戶信任,促進(jìn)全球業(yè)務(wù)增長。

關(guān)鍵點回顧

  1. 設(shè)計規(guī)范化:避免冗余,合理使用索引。
  2. 查詢優(yōu)化:減少JOIN,使用緩存。
  3. 服務(wù)器調(diào)優(yōu):調(diào)整參數(shù),讀寫分離。
  4. 數(shù)據(jù)管理:定期清理,歸檔歷史數(shù)據(jù)。
  5. 監(jiān)控維護:自動化腳本,實時監(jiān)控。

通過持續(xù)優(yōu)化,外貿(mào)網(wǎng)站可以在高并發(fā)、大數(shù)據(jù)量的環(huán)境下保持穩(wěn)定高效的運行,為企業(yè)創(chuàng)造更大的商業(yè)價值。

相關(guān)文章

佛山網(wǎng)站建設(shè)指南,從零開始打造您的在線門戶

本文目錄導(dǎo)讀:佛山網(wǎng)站建設(shè)的現(xiàn)狀與趨勢選擇佛山網(wǎng)站建設(shè)服務(wù)商的要點佛山網(wǎng)站建設(shè)的步驟佛山網(wǎng)站建設(shè)的成本分析佛山網(wǎng)站建設(shè)的成功案例在當(dāng)今數(shù)字化時代,擁有一個功能齊全、設(shè)計精美的網(wǎng)站對于任何企業(yè)或個人來說...

佛山網(wǎng)站建設(shè)方案報價詳解,如何選擇性價比最高的建站服務(wù)

本文目錄導(dǎo)讀:佛山網(wǎng)站建設(shè)的基本流程佛山網(wǎng)站建設(shè)報價的影響因素佛山網(wǎng)站建設(shè)報價的常見模式如何選擇性價比最高的建站服務(wù)佛山網(wǎng)站建設(shè)報價的市場行情在當(dāng)今數(shù)字化時代,企業(yè)網(wǎng)站已成為品牌展示、客戶溝通和業(yè)務(wù)拓...

正規(guī)的佛山網(wǎng)站建設(shè),如何打造專業(yè)、高效的企業(yè)網(wǎng)站?

本文目錄導(dǎo)讀:什么是正規(guī)的佛山網(wǎng)站建設(shè)?佛山企業(yè)為什么需要正規(guī)的網(wǎng)站建設(shè)?正規(guī)佛山網(wǎng)站建設(shè)的關(guān)鍵步驟如何選擇正規(guī)的佛山網(wǎng)站建設(shè)服務(wù)商?在當(dāng)今數(shù)字化時代,企業(yè)網(wǎng)站不僅是展示品牌形象的窗口,更是與客戶溝通...

佛山網(wǎng)站建設(shè)哪家好?如何選擇最適合的網(wǎng)站建設(shè)公司

本文目錄導(dǎo)讀:佛山網(wǎng)站建設(shè)市場的現(xiàn)狀如何選擇適合的網(wǎng)站建設(shè)公司佛山網(wǎng)站建設(shè)公司推薦網(wǎng)站建設(shè)的常見誤區(qū)在當(dāng)今數(shù)字化時代,網(wǎng)站已經(jīng)成為企業(yè)展示形象、推廣產(chǎn)品和服務(wù)的重要窗口,無論是大型企業(yè)還是中小型企業(yè),...

佛山網(wǎng)站建設(shè)與維護,打造數(shù)字化時代的核心競爭力

本文目錄導(dǎo)讀:佛山網(wǎng)站建設(shè)的重要性佛山網(wǎng)站建設(shè)的關(guān)鍵步驟佛山網(wǎng)站維護的重要性與內(nèi)容佛山網(wǎng)站建設(shè)與維護的未來趨勢在數(shù)字化時代,網(wǎng)站已經(jīng)成為企業(yè)、機構(gòu)甚至個人展示形象、傳遞信息和開展業(yè)務(wù)的重要平臺,作為中...

佛山網(wǎng)站建設(shè)電話,打造數(shù)字化未來的關(guān)鍵一步

本文目錄導(dǎo)讀:佛山網(wǎng)站建設(shè)的重要性佛山網(wǎng)站建設(shè)的流程如何通過電話咨詢獲取專業(yè)的服務(wù)佛山網(wǎng)站建設(shè)電話的作用佛山網(wǎng)站建設(shè)的未來趨勢在當(dāng)今數(shù)字化時代,網(wǎng)站已經(jīng)成為企業(yè)、機構(gòu)乃至個人展示形象、推廣產(chǎn)品和服務(wù)的...

發(fā)表評論

訪客

看不清,換一張

◎歡迎參與討論,請在這里發(fā)表您的看法和觀點。